Black-Eyed Peas and Ham Hocks
This recipe for black-eyed peas with ham hocks is my mom's, and she was from Arkansas. Once cooked, a portion of the peas may be mashed, then stirred together with the whole peas and shredded ham hock for a creamier consistency.

Make-Ahead Hot Buttered Rum Mix
This is an easy, delicious hot-buttered rum that doesn't require cream or ice cream. Keep the mixture on hand in the fridge for use anytime. You can substitute 1/2 cup hot strong coffee or tea for the rum and boiling water.

Chef John's Party Cheese Puffs
These beautiful cheese puffs, gougeres, are as easy as they are delicious. Usually Gruyere cheese is used but I had some very sharp farmhouse Cheddar cheese in the fridge, so I decided to use that. As long as you are using a very sharp, full-flavored cheese I don't think you can go wrong. I love gougeres with Gruyere, but I think the extra-sharp Cheddar was just as good.
